Hi Grzegorz,
On Friday 05 of September 2014 15:55:41 Grzegorz Kolodziejczyk wrote:
> Data strings should be byte format.
> ---
> android/client/if-gatt.c | 12 +++++++++++-
> 1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
>
> diff --git a/android/client/if-gatt.c b/android/client/if-gatt.c
> index c8352b5..0dee225 100644
> --- a/android/client/if-gatt.c
> +++ b/android/client/if-gatt.c
> @@ -114,11 +114,17 @@ const btgatt_interface_t *if_gatt = NULL;
>
> #define GET_VERIFY_HEX_STRING(n, v, l) \
> do { \
> + int ll;\
> if (n[0] != '0' || (n[1] != 'X' && n[1] != 'x')) { \
> haltest_error("Value must be hex string\n"); \
> return; \
> } \
> - l = fill_buffer(n + 2, (uint8_t *) v, sizeof(v)); \
> + ll = fill_buffer(n + 2, (uint8_t *) v, sizeof(v)); \
> + if (ll < 0) { \
> + haltest_error("Value must be byte hex string\n"); \
> + return; \
> + } \
> + l = ll; \
> } while (0)
>
> /* Gatt uses little endian uuid */
> @@ -803,6 +809,10 @@ static int fill_buffer(const char *str, uint8_t *out,
> int out_size)
>
> str_len = strlen(str);
>
> + /* Hex string must be byte format */
> + if (str_len%2 != 0)
> + return -1;
There should be spaces around '%'. I've fixed this myself but please pay
attention to coding style.
> +
> for (i = 0, j = 0; i < out_size && j < str_len; i++, j++) {
> c = str[j];
Patch applied. Thanks.
